Best Practices

  • Create a dedicated study space: Designate a specific area for studying that is free from distractions and clutter.
  • Set specific goals: Break down your study sessions into smaller, manageable goals to help maintain focus and track progress.
  • Practice time management: Use techniques like the Pomodoro Technique to allocate focused study periods followed by short breaks.
  • Minimize digital distractions: Turn off notifications, put your phone on silent mode, and use website blockers to avoid temptation.
  • Use active learning techniques: Engage with the material through techniques like summarizing, questioning, and teaching to maintain focus and improve retention.

Methods

The Pomodoro Technique

The Pomodoro Technique is a time management method that helps maximize focus and productivity. Here's how it works:

  1. Set a timer for 25 minutes, called a 'Pomodoro'.
  2. Work on a task with full focus until the timer goes off.
  3. Take a 5-minute break once the Pomodoro is completed.
  4. After completing four Pomodoros, take a longer break (e.g., 15-30 minutes).

The 2-Minute Rule

The 2-Minute Rule is a strategy to overcome procrastination and maintain focus. The rule is simple:

  • If a task takes less than 2 minutes to complete, do it immediately.
  • By tackling small tasks and eliminating quick distractions, you can stay on track with your studies.

The Chunking Method

The Chunking Method involves breaking down large tasks into smaller, more manageable chunks. By focusing on one chunk at a time, you can maintain your attention without becoming overwhelmed. This method is particularly useful for tasks that seem daunting or complex.

Potential Online Apps that Relate to the Topic

  • Forest: A mobile app that gamifies focus and concentration by rewarding users with a virtual tree for every study session completed without interruption.
  • Freedom: This app blocks distracting websites and apps for a set period, helping users stay focused during study sessions.
  • RescueTime: It tracks your digital habits, providing insights on time spent on different activities. It can help identify distractions and improve focus.
  • Focus@Will: This app offers curated playlists of background music specifically designed to enhance focus and concentration.
  • Anki: Anki is a flashcard app that uses spaced repetition to help users memorize information more effectively.
